Carvedilol - 6.25 mg or 12.5 mg or 25 mg. Package 30 capsules.
α1- and β- adrenoceptor antagonist, without symptomatic action, antianginal, hypotensive, antioxidant, vasodilating, antiarrhythmic, antiproliferative action.
arterial hypertension;
exertional angina;
chronic cardiac decompensation II-III class according to NYHA, in combination with diuretics, digoxin or inhibitors ACE (angiotensin converting enzyme).
Intake. Dose is selected individually. Arterial hypertension: The first 2 days dose is 6.25 – 12.5 mg 1 time daily in the morning. Maintaining dose 25 mg carvedilol daily. In case of insufficient effect increase the dose to max. 50 mg daily (2 intakes). Exertional angina: Initial dose 12.5 mg 2 times daily during the first 2 days. Maintaining dose 25 mg 2 times daily. In case of insufficient effect increase the dose to max. 50 mg daily (2 intakes). For elderly patients after 70 daily dose is NMT 50 mg. Chronic cardiac decompensation: Initial dose is 6.25 mg 1 time daily during 2 weeks. Under good tolerance increase the dose with an interval of 2 weeks up to 6.25 mg 2 times daily, then 12.5 mg 2 times daily, then 25 mg 2 times daily.
